Centene Corp
HEALTHCARE · HEALTHCARE PLANS · USA
Centene Corporation is a large publicly traded company and a multi-line managed care enterprise that serves as a major intermediary for both government-sponsored and privately insured health care programs. It is a healthcare insurer that focuses on managed care for uninsured, underinsured, and low-income individuals.
Sanofi ADR
HEALTHCARE · DRUG MANUFACTURERS - GENERAL · USA
Sanofi, a healthcare company, is engaged in the research, development, manufacture, and marketing of therapeutic solutions in the United States, Europe, and internationally. The company is headquartered in Paris, France.
